[1/2] lib: add helper to read strings from sysfs files

Commit Message

Tomasz Duszynski Jan. 25, 2023, 10:38 a.m. UTC
  Reading strings from sysfs files is a re-occurring pattern
hence add helper for doing that.

Signed-off-by: Tomasz Duszynski <tduszynski@marvell.com>
---
 app/test/test_eal_fs.c          | 108 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----
 lib/eal/common/eal_filesystem.h |   6 ++
 lib/eal/unix/eal_filesystem.c   |  24 ++++---
 lib/eal/version.map             |   1 +
 4 files changed, 121 insertions(+), 18 deletions(-)

diff --git a/lib/eal/unix/eal_filesystem.c b/lib/eal/unix/eal_filesystem.c
index afbab9368a..8ed10094be 100644
--- a/lib/eal/unix/eal_filesystem.c
+++ b/lib/eal/unix/eal_filesystem.c
@@ -76,12 +76,9 @@  int eal_create_runtime_dir(void)
 	return 0;
 }
 
-/* parse a sysfs (or other) file containing one integer value */
-int eal_parse_sysfs_value(const char *filename, unsigned long *val)
+int eal_parse_sysfs_string(const char *filename, char *str, size_t size)
 {
 	FILE *f;
-	char buf[BUFSIZ];
-	char *end = NULL;
 
 	if ((f = fopen(filename, "r")) == NULL) {
 		RTE_LOG(ERR, EAL, "%s(): cannot open sysfs value %s\n",
@@ -89,19 +86,32 @@  int eal_parse_sysfs_value(const char *filename, unsigned long *val)
 		return -1;
 	}
 
-	if (fgets(buf, sizeof(buf), f) == NULL) {
+	if (fgets(str, size, f) == NULL) {
 		RTE_LOG(ERR, EAL, "%s(): cannot read sysfs value %s\n",
 			__func__, filename);
 		fclose(f);
 		return -1;
 	}
+	fclose(f);
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/* parse a sysfs (or other) file containing one integer value */
+int eal_parse_sysfs_value(const char *filename, unsigned long *val)
+{
+	char buf[BUFSIZ];
+	char *end = NULL;
+	int ret;
+
+	ret = eal_parse_sysfs_string(filename, buf, sizeof(buf));
+	if (ret < 0)
+		return ret;
+
 	*val = strtoul(buf, &end, 0);
 	if ((buf[0] == '\0') || (end == NULL) || (*end != '\n')) {
 		RTE_LOG(ERR, EAL, "%s(): cannot parse sysfs value %s\n",
 				__func__, filename);
-		fclose(f);
 		return -1;
 	}
-	fclose(f);
 	return 0;
 }
